More Planned Romance:
If you’ve made
the efforts to complete an entire week of romance with your spouse,
you may or may not have been able to come up with your own ideas.
If you find that you haven’t been bit with the romance inspiration
bug on your own, you can plan several weeks of romance for you and
your spouse with a few more suggestions. Once you’ve implemented
the ideas that work for you and you’ve been doing them for a
while, you are sure to be inspired with your own thoughts and ideas.
Start your week off
on Sunday and keep in mind that it is a wonderful day to remain low-key
and enjoy time alone with your spouse. Take a long walk without cell
phones, iPods, or any other distracting devices. Just you and your
spouse should take a walk and enjoy each other’s company. Hold
hands while you walk. You can also spend the day in your bedroom,
keep the curtains drawn, and light some candles. You are in charge
of whatever else happens there. On the other hand, you can spend the
entire day in bed with the curtains open and read the paper to each
other or watch movies all day. Eat your meals in bed. (Making love
is definitely an option as well!)
On Monday, wake up
with the birds. Enjoy a morning together without the normal rush you
typically go through. Go to a music store and buy a romantic CD to
present to your spouse. Enjoy it together before going to bed. Mondays
are also great for calling in sick to repeat an exceptional Sunday
again.
Tuesdays are great
days to wake up early and begin making love with your spouse. On another
Tuesday, try reading something you both find to be inspirational aloud.
As an alternative activity for particularly busy Tuesdays, send your
spouse loving thoughts by using mental telepathy. You don’t
think it works? Try it and you’ll see.
Wednesdays are always
difficult days of the week because they are only the halfway mark
to the anticipated weekend. Do something different like taking a class
together, give each other massages (or just give him or her massage)
or have dinner together. In fact, pack a picnic lunch, meet him or
her at work and either eat there or leave to eat at a park or even
in the car.
You must remember that
Thursday is always gift day. When you are at a store and you spot
something your spouse might enjoy or you know he or she will love,
you should start picking those items up and storing them for Thursdays.
You should never run out of gifts this way and you must never miss
gift day!
Friday is always a
day to look forward to! When your spouse comes home from work, have
‘your’ song playing on the radio. If you took dance classes
together on Wednesday, they will come in handy! Draw him or her bath
and share it together.
Saturday is your day
to be creative. Think about his or her favorite artist (music, painting,
sculpture, etc.) and buy them some of their work. Make love, but make
up some fun rules like you can’t open your eyes or you can’t
use your hands. Make a decadent dessert and feed it to each other.
Start all over again when you wake up Sunday morning!
To do things more than
once is wonderful if you both enjoy it. But make sure you aren’t
doing the same things too often. While you may be enjoying something,
your spouse may have already tired of it. It’s not romance when
only one of you has their heart in it.
